Includes bibliographical references
Prologue The thrill of the quill -- Introduction Legal ease -- Chapter 1 Phases of writing -- Chapter 2 Readability -- Chapter 3 Structure & substance -- Chapter 4 A style is born -- Chapter 5 Objective writing -- Chapter 6 Persuasive writing -- Chapter 7 Creative writing -- Chapter 8 Contract writing -- Chapter 9 Legislative writing -- Chapter 10 Regulatory writing -- Chapter 11 Decision writing -- Chapter 12 E-mail & letter writing -- Chapter 13 Textbook writing -- Chapter 14 Technical writing -- Chapter 15 Editing & grammar -- Chapter 16 Writer's block -- Chapter 17 Ambiguity -- Epilogue License to chill.
